2026年05月30日 ai-code

TestAI Editor 深度评测:2026年最佳 ai-code 工具?

为您带来 TestAI Editor 的详尽评测。多维度解析其功能表现、优缺点、详细定价以及最佳替代工具。

在 AI 编程工具爆发式增长的 2026 年,开发者面临的选择焦虑比以往任何时候都更严重。从 GitHub Copilot 到 Cursor,从 Windsurf 到 Codeium,每一款工具都在争夺开发者的工作流入口。在这样的红海竞争中,一款名为 TestAI Editor 的开源项目悄然崛起,凭借其极致的补全速度和深度代码库语义索引能力,在 GitHub 上获得了大量关注。它究竟是开发者翘首以盼的生产力利器,还是又一个昙花一现的概念产品?本文将从功能实测、性能表现、定价策略和竞品对比等多个维度,为您带来最全面的深度评测。

TestAI Editor Homepage Screenshot

工具概述

TestAI Editor 定位为一款高级 AI 驱动的文本与代码编辑器,其核心使命是通过智能自动补全和内联重构功能,显著提升开发者的编码效率。与许多仅提供表层代码建议的工具不同,TestAI Editor 的技术架构建立在对整个代码库的深度语义理解之上——它不仅仅是在”猜测”你接下来要输入什么,而是在”理解”你的项目结构、依赖关系和编码意图之后,给出上下文精准的建议。

从适用人群来看,TestAI Editor 覆盖面相当广泛。对于全栈开发者而言,它能够跨越前端与后端的技术栈边界,提供一致的智能补全体验;对于大型项目的维护者,其深度代码库索引能力意味着在面对数百万行遗留代码时,AI 助手依然能够精准定位上下文并给出有价值的重构建议;对于独立开发者和小型团队,其慷慨的免费额度和极具竞争力的付费定价,使得高质量 AI 编程辅助不再是大厂的专属特权。

值得一提的是,TestAI Editor 采用开源模式发布,这意味着社区可以深度参与其演进过程,同时也为技术敏感型企业提供了审计代码安全性的可能性。在信任成本日益高昂的 AI 工具领域,这一策略无疑是明智的。

核心功能与实测体验

极速自动补全:肉眼可见的效率提升

TestAI Editor 最令人印象深刻的特性,莫过于其极致的补全响应速度。在为期两周的密集实测中,我们使用多种编程语言(Python、TypeScript、Rust、Go)在不同规模的项目中进行了对比测试。结果显示,TestAI Editor 的补全建议从触发到呈现的平均延迟仅为 45-80 毫秒,这一数据在同类工具中处于顶尖水平。

具体到开发场景中,这种速度优势体现得尤为明显。在编写常规的 CRUD 逻辑时,TestAI Editor 几乎能够在你键入每个字符的瞬间就呈现出完整的代码块建议,开发者的思维流几乎不会被打断。与某些竞品在复杂上下文中频繁出现的”转圈等待”现象形成鲜明对比,TestAI Editor 的流畅体验让人真正体会到了 AI 辅助编程的理想状态。

深度代码库语义索引:不只是”读代码”

TestAI Editor 的第二大核心能力是其深度代码库语义索引(Deep Codebase Semantic Index)。这项功能在底层构建了一个涵盖项目全局的语义图谱,理解模块之间的调用关系、类型流转、以及隐含的架构约束。

在测试中,我们将其应用于一个拥有超过 50 万行代码的 React + Node.js 全栈项目。当我们修改一个核心数据模型的字段定义时,TestAI Editor 不仅能够准确识别出所有直接引用该字段的位置,还能追溯到间接依赖——例如通过 API 响应传递后在前端组件中被解构使用的场景。这种级别的代码理解能力,使得其重构建议的准确率远超基于简单模式匹配的传统工具。

更令人惊喜的是,当我们在一个微服务架构的项目中工作时,TestAI Editor 的语义索引能够跨越服务边界建立关联。修改一个共享数据类型的定义后,它会主动提示下游服务中需要同步更新的代码位置,这种全局视野对于维护分布式系统的开发者而言价值巨大。

内联重构:精准且可控

除了补全能力之外,TestAI Editor 的**内联重构(Inline Refactoring)**功能同样值得称道。开发者只需选中一段代码,通过简单的快捷键操作即可触发重构建议。测试中,无论是将回调函数转换为 async/await 模式、提取重复逻辑为独立函数,还是优化条件表达式的可读性,TestAI Editor 给出的重构方案都展现出了对代码语义的深度理解,而非简单的语法模板替换。

我们特别测试了它在处理复杂嵌套逻辑时的表现:面对一段包含多层条件分支和循环嵌套的函数,TestAI Editor 成功将其重构为职责清晰的多个子函数,并自动推断出了合理的函数命名和参数设计。虽然偶有需要人工微调的地方,但整体完成度令人满意。

优缺点详析

优势

1. 补全速度行业领先

这不仅是技术指标上的优势,更是开发体验上的质变。当 AI 补全的速度快到”无感”的程度,开发者的工作流会从”等待 AI → 确认 → 继续输入”转变为”自然输入 → AI 在旁辅助”的无缝协作模式。这种体验上的差异,只有在长时间使用后才能真正体会到其价值。

2. 深度代码库语义索引

TestAI Editor 的语义索引不是简单的关键词匹配或 AST 分析的产物,而是构建在多层理解之上的智能系统。它能够理解代码的”意图”而非仅仅是”结构”,这使得它在复杂项目中的表现远超同类工具。对于在大型企业级代码库中工作的开发者而言,这一特性极具吸引力。

3. 极具成本效益的定价策略

免费版提供了足以覆盖个人开发者日常需求的核心功能,而每月仅 10 美元的付费方案则解锁了完整的高级功能。在竞品普遍定价 15-20 美元/月的市场环境下,TestAI Editor 的性价比优势显著,尤其适合预算有限但对工具有品质要求的开发者和小型团队。

局限

1. 对网络带宽要求较高

TestAI Editor 的实时语义索引和极速补全能力,在一定程度上依赖于持续的云端数据同步。在我们的测试中,当网络环境从 Wi-Fi 切换到移动热点(下行约 10Mbps)时,补全延迟明显上升至 200-400 毫秒,部分高级重构功能甚至出现了超时的情况。对于经常在网络条件不稳定环境中工作的开发者(如远程办公、出差场景),这是一个需要认真考虑的因素。

2. 大型索引构建时的 UI 冻结问题

首次打开一个大型项目时,TestAI Editor 需要构建完整的代码库语义索引。在我们的测试中,面对一个超过 100 万行代码的仓库,索引构建过程耗时约 8 分钟,期间编辑器出现了间歇性的 UI 冻结现象,严重时编辑器窗口完全无响应长达 15-20 秒。虽然索引一旦构建完成即会被缓存,后续打开同一项目时不会重复此过程,但对于需要频繁切换项目的开发者而言,这一问题确实影响了首次使用体验。值得期待的是,项目团队已在 GitHub Issues 中确认正在优化索引构建的异步处理流程。

定价方案对比

TestAI Editor 采用**免费增值(Freemium)**的定价模式,具体分为两个层级:

方案价格核心功能
Free$0基础智能补全、单文件语义理解、内联重构(基础)、社区支持
Pro$10/月全量代码库语义索引、跨文件重构建议、优先模型访问、高级语言支持、优先技术支持

免费版的功能完整度令人印象深刻。对于编写独立脚本、小型项目或学习编程的用户而言,免费版已经能够提供远超传统编辑器的编码体验。它不设硬性的每日请求限制,仅在高级功能(如全局语义索引和跨文件重构)上进行了限制。

Pro 版每月 10 美元的定价在市场中具有明显的竞争力。横向对比来看,GitHub Copilot Individual 同样定价 10 美元/月,但其代码库级别的理解能力不及 TestAI Editor 的语义索引;Cursor Pro 定价 20 美元/月,虽然功能丰富但价格翻倍;Codeium 的免费方案虽然慷慨,但在深度重构能力上有所欠缺。综合来看,TestAI Editor 的 Pro 版是目前市场上每美元价值最高的 AI 编程工具之一。

对于企业用户,TestAI Editor 目前尚未推出专门的 Team 或 Enterprise 方案,但考虑到其开源特性,企业完全可以通过私有部署来满足数据安全和合规要求。据项目维护者在 GitHub Discussions 中透露,团队版方案已在规划中,预计将包含集中管理、审计日志和自定义模型微调等企业级特性。

竞品与替代方案

为了帮助开发者做出更全面的决策,我们将 TestAI Editor 与当前市场上的主要竞品进行了横向对比:

TestAI Editor vs GitHub Copilot

GitHub Copilot 的最大优势在于其与 GitHub 生态的深度集成以及庞大的用户基数。然而,在代码库级别的语义理解方面,TestAI Editor 的深度索引机制展现出了明显的优势。特别是在处理复杂重构任务时,TestAI Editor 给出的建议通常更加精准和完整。此外,TestAI Editor 的开源特性为企业用户提供了更高的透明度和可控性。

TestAI Editor vs Cursor

Cursor 作为”AI-First”编辑器的代表,在整体交互设计和多模型支持方面表现出色。然而,其 20 美元/月的定价几乎是 TestAI Editor Pro 的两倍。在实际的代码补全质量上,两者各有千秋——Cursor 在创意性代码生成方面略有优势,而 TestAI Editor 在大型项目中的精准补全和重构能力更胜一筹。预算敏感型开发者可能会更倾向于 TestAI Editor。

TestAI Editor vs Windsurf (原 Codeium)

Windsurf 提供了慷慨的免费方案和流畅的基础体验,但在深度代码理解和高级重构能力上,TestAI Editor 的表现更为突出。对于仅需基础补全功能的开发者,Windsurf 的免费方案可能已经足够;但如果你追求的是对大型代码库的深度理解和精准重构,TestAI Editor 是更优的选择。

TestAI Editor vs Augment Code

Augment Code 专注于企业级大型代码库场景,在某些特定场景下的表现可圈可点。但其面向企业的定价策略和较重的部署要求,使得个人开发者和小型团队难以触及。TestAI Editor 在保持企业级代码理解能力的同时,提供了更加亲民的价格和更轻量的使用门槛。

评测总结与购买建议

经过两周的深度实测和全方位对比分析,TestAI Editor 给我们留下了深刻的印象。它不是一款”面面俱到”的工具——它没有花哨的聊天界面,不支持自然语言生成完整应用,也不会试图成为一个全能的 AI 开发平台。相反,它选择了一条更加务实的技术路径:将代码补全和语义理解这两件事情做到极致

综合评分:4.6 / 5.0

分项评分如下:

  • 补全质量:★★★★★ — 响应速度和准确性均处于行业顶尖水平
  • 代码理解深度:★★★★★ — 深度语义索引是其核心差异化优势
  • 用户体验:★★★★☆ — 整体流畅,但大型索引构建时的 UI 冻结扣分
  • 性价比:★★★★★ — 10 美元/月的定价极具竞争力
  • 生态与扩展性:★★★★☆ — 开源社区活跃,但企业版方案尚待完善

推荐人群:

  • 在大型代码库中工作的全栈开发者和后端工程师
  • 追求极致补全效率、对延迟敏感的高频编码者
  • 预算有限但不愿在工具品质上妥协的独立开发者和小团队
  • 对代码工具的数据安全性有要求的企业技术团队(可私有部署)

暂不推荐人群:

  • 长期在网络条件不稳定的环境下工作的开发者(带宽要求高)
  • 需要频繁在超大型项目间快速切换的开发者(索引构建体验待优化)
  • 追求一站式 AI 开发体验(含聊天、部署、监控)的用户

总体而言,TestAI Editor 是 2026 年 AI 编程工具领域的一匹值得关注的黑马。它用实际表现证明,在一个充斥着”全能 AI”叙事的市场中,将核心功能做到极致同样是通往卓越的有效路径。如果你正在寻找一款能够真正融入日常工作流、而非仅仅作为炫技展示的 AI 编程助手,TestAI Editor 值得你认真尝试。